What the Standards Require

Programs supplied to your customers are built to ANSI/ISEA Z87.1 and support their obligations under OSHA 29 CFR 1910.133 and 1926.102. Prescription eyewear is supplied on Z87-2 marked frames with the impact, splash and dust markings each customer's hazard assessment requires.

Markings are the practical check: if a prescription frame does not carry Z87-2, it is not compliant protective eyewear regardless of how it is sold. Our labs supply every pair marked to the ratings your hazard assessment calls for.

Frequently Asked Questions

Does the employer have to pay for prescription safety glasses in Safety Distributors?

It depends on the eyewear. Under OSHA 29 CFR 1910.132(h) the employer must pay for required PPE, but there is a specific exemption: non-specialty prescription safety eyewear does not have to be employer-paid provided the employer lets employees wear it off the job site. Anything specialty - prescription inserts, sealed or gasketed frames, welding filters, or eyewear that cannot reasonably leave site - falls back under the employer-pays rule. Most Safety Distributors programs are funded anyway, because a company-paid allowance is what actually drives compliance.
